Timbershade is touch-dry in approximately 30 minutes and hard-dry in about one hour. Allow two to three hours before applying the next coat.
Although it dries quickly, avoid heavy handling or exposing the surface to water until the paint has dried thoroughly. Drying time may vary depending on temperature, humidity, ventilation and coating thickness.
Wood paint can fade due to prolonged sunlight and weather exposure. Peeling or patchiness may occur when the surface is damp, dirty, greasy, unevenly sanded or coated before the previous layer has dried properly.
Using an unsuitable coating system or applying paint over loose existing paint can also weaken adhesion. Proper cleaning, sanding and application of the recommended undercoat and topcoats help produce a more even and durable result.
Timbershade uses a premium water-based acrylic paint formulation that dries to form a durable solid-colour coating over the wood. The acrylic binder helps the paint adhere to a properly prepared surface and provides lasting colour and protection for interior and exterior use.
Because it is water-based, it also has lower odour and environmental impact than conventional solvent-based paints, while offering fast drying and easy water clean-up after application.
Ensure that the wood is dry and free from dirt, grease, dust and other contaminants. Sand the surface until smooth, then remove all sanding residue before painting.
For previously painted wood, scrape away loose or flaking paint and sand uneven areas until smooth. A clean, dry and stable surface helps Timbershade adhere properly and produce a more even finish.
Timbershade is recommended specifically for galvanised iron rather than all types of metal. The surface should be dry and free from grease, dirt and other contaminants.
Remove any loose or flaking existing paint, then sand defective areas smooth. Apply the recommended primer before finishing with Timbershade. For other metal types, consult Nippon Paint for the appropriate coating system.
Make sure the fibre cement board is dry, clean and free from dust, dirt and other contaminants. Remove any loose particles and ensure the surface is sound before painting.
Conveniently, Timbershade can then be applied directly as the topcoat in two coats, following the recommended drying time between coats.

Apply two coats of Timbershade for even colour coverage and lasting protection. Allow approximately two to three hours between coats.
For wood and galvanised iron, apply the recommended undercoat or primer first. Actual coverage and the number of coats required may vary depending on the surface condition, porosity, colour and application method.
